Evidence — Discovery and inspection — Privilege — Waiver — Whether disclosure was of “significant part” of document — Whether unfair to claim confidentiality maintained — Whether evidence of detriment to plaintiff — Whether senior police officer could waive legal privilege — Whether senior police officer did waive legal privilege — “Significant part” — Evidence Act 2006, ss 3, 7, 54 and 65.
Constitutional law — Executive powers — Whether Crown legal privilege could only be waived by Attorney-General — Whether senior police officer could waive legal privilege — Whether senior police officer did waive legal privilege — Whether circumstances of disclosure inconsistent with claim of confidentiality — Evidence Act 2006, ss 3 and 65.
